Director: James Gartner
During a period of significant social change, the Texas Western Miners basketball team faced immense challenges. Coach Don Haskins made a bold decision to field the first all-black starting lineup in college basketball, defying convention and prejudice. The team’s improbable journey culminated in an unexpected NCAA tournament championship victory in 1966, leaving an indelible mark on the sport and challenging racial barriers across the nation.
